    Boston College Introduction

     

    Founded in 1863, Boston College is a Jesuit, Catholic university located six miles from downtown Boston with an enrollment of 9,484 full-time undergraduates and 5,250 graduate and professional students. Ranked 35 among national universities, Boston College has 888 full-time and 1,281 FTE faculty, 2,711 non-faculty employees, an operating budget of $1.4 billion, and an endowment in excess of $3.5 billion.

    Job Description

    Support multiple areas of the Law School by performing reporting, data modeling, and financial modeling tasks; developing and supporting data collection, storage, and security; leading special projects for the dean’s office; analyzing marketing data; and driving strategic decision making and problem solving. Duties include:

     

    •Collect, analyze, and submit all data related to the Law School’s accreditation and surveys including but not limited to ABA, US News, National Association of Law Placement and Princeton Review.

    •Build, maintain, and present data models that track and predict various rankings.

    •Analyze the US News & ABA annual survey and submission process and re-accreditation process when applicable.

    •Remain current on ABA accreditation requirements and manage the annual ABA annual questionnaire submission and re-accreditation process.

    •Review data collection methods and identify areas for improvements.

    •Build and maintain central data warehouse for law school data.

    •Represent the Law School while working with Institutional Research & Planning (IR&P) and Information Technology (ITS) on projects related to the Boston College Enterprise Data Warehouse (EDW).

    •Build, update, and maintain key financial models for the Associate Dean, Finance & Administration, including the five-year tuition and tuition remission projections.

    •Design and automate various financial reports.

    •Collaborate with the Associate Dean to build financial forecasts and projections.

    •Collaborate with business partners, cross-functional teams, and other departments focused on delivering data analytics across various data platforms.

    •Assist the Director of Marketing & Communications in managing analytical data, and present periodic and annual reports on traffic and analysis for various web presences.

    •Work with the marketing team to manage and analyze social media traffic.

    Requirements

    Master’s degree (or foreign equivalent) in Data Analytics, Urban Informatics, Statistics, or a related field followed by 2 years of experience in a data analytics-related occupation.

    Experience must include the following, which may have been gained concurrently:

    1) 2 years of experience using business intelligence tools including Tableau, QuickSight, SAS, SQL, or Tableau to build dashboards and reports, and creating deep-dive analysis to influence business decisions.

     

    2) 2 years of experience performing root cause analysis using SQL to retrieve and analyze data.

     

    3) 2 years of experience conducting statistical data analysis to measure effectiveness and success of various programs.

     

    4) 2 years of experience defining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to enable data-driven decision making and strategic improvements across various departments.

     

    5) 2 years of experience making presentations about complex analytical concepts to large groups and working collaboratively with cross-functional teams.

     

    6) 2 years of experience developing JSON scripts.

     

    7) 2 years of experience profiling, investigating, and interpreting data analysis.

     

    8) 2 years of experience detailing data requirements, data modelling techniques, and hands-on modelling.

     

    9) 2 years of experience utilizing SQL, Stata, or Ror.
